One of Italy's many fascinating regions, the most charming from my point of view, is Tuscany.

In Tuscany there is a very scenic village called Pitigliano. It is build on a rocky conformation, has two rivers running at its sides and is surrounded by hills. A natural fortress.

One of this hills is called by the locals "Poggio Strozzoni", that loosely translated stands for "Stangler's Hill". Legends says that one of the Count Orsini strangled a wife there, but we know better than to believe in legends, do we?

When I was a kid I used to go and play up there a lot, and from there I could see the ruins of an old monastery, San Francesco's. Do you remember how that kind of stuff fascinated you when you were a kid? It certainly fascinated me, but I could never access it, as I was "not allowed to". Yep, I was that good a kid!

Years passed, and the fascination remained. I have passed in front of it many times with a car, but too busy to stop and give a look. Till suddenly, a day not many weeks ago, I decided to stop and take pictures. I was a god kid, an sadly I am a good guy now (shame on me), so I went to ask permission to whomever owned the place.

The owners turned out to be two fascinating ladies from New York, set up in the hill to restore the monastery. They were glad to let me take pictures, so I did, and I am going to put a selection of them here soon. Had I waited a few more months to stop passing in front of it I would have never seen how charming it is from the other side of the road.

As you see, sometimes it pays to be good :-)
